The Womier ERA75 is a hot-swappable aluminum mechanical keyboard designed for those who love to build and personalize their typing setup. With six stunning colorways, a detachable volume knob, and a customizable sticker, the ERA75 makes every desk setup both stylish and fun to play with.

What do YouTubers say about the ERA75?

  • BiboyHaranero --- A special keyboard aesthetically.

“In terms of gaming, this performs as expected. No complaints with delays or interference, thanks to its 1000Hz polling rate and all key anti-ghosting. So gamers out there, this will perform.”

“In terms of software, this is VIA compatible. So advanced key binding with multiple layers, layout options, macro recording, and RGB customization is available.”

“Speaking of keycaps, the ERA75 is compatible even with ISO layouts. The stabilizer here performs really well. And by really well, I mean, they do not wobble on the positioning plate. They’re also pre-lubricated. Overall, I will not replace them. I will not relube them. I would not even touch them.”

  • keebdude --- Not Your Average Aluminium Keyboard.

“Its looks are quite unique in comparison to other keyboard releases. ”

“The typing experience is towards the stiffer side, despite being gasket-mounted and having a flex cut PC plate. But don’t get me wrong. It still has some flex to it and is much better than a tray-mounted board. The sound is typical of a fully foamed-up board and what you may clarify as creamy and thocky.”

“It’s fun to apply the stickers. It took about an hour, and it wasn’t difficult at all except for the tiny stickers.”

  • Rx003 --- A new look for custom keyboards!

“Design-wise,I really like what Womier did here. It feels fresh and definitely stands out among the other 75% that we have. I would admit the DIY sticker idea might seem gimmicky at first, but for beginners or anyone just get into the hobby, it’s actually a fun way to personalize the board. Honestly, the board still looks great even without the stickers. So you are not locked into using them.”

“Onto the sound, what really impressed me is that it doesn’t really rely on the foam to sound good. There’s also no ping, no hollowess, even with the foam removed. So whenever you are into a softer or more muted board, or want a clacky, you got options. It sounds clean, balanced, and not too harsh; either way, the board feels solid and delivers a simple and clean sound straight out of the box, and the design stands out in my opinion.

What do reviewers say about the ERA75?

  • Digitalchumps --- A cool keyboard that nails comfort, sturdiness, and coolness perfectly.

”The design of the ERA75 is both comfortable and sturdy. I don’t often enjoy smaller keyboards, not nearly as much as hardcore gamers, but this one had me forgetting its size.  Being a big-handed monster, I generally dread smaller-sized keyboards, as they always make my fingers feel cramped, and the efficiency of the smaller keyboard can render it unusable. The ERA75 does a great job of avoiding those issues, as key space is good and quick, and, more importantly, comfortable.”

“The ERA75 offers some flexibility to its functionality. The keys are gasket-mounted, which makes them comfortable (and creamy) to type on. Hearing that sweet-sweet click of a noisy keyboard, while also not tiring one’s fingers, is a Godsend. The keyboard is great for typing and delivering that creamy sound.”

  • PCMag --- A keyboard with bags of personality and a design that genuinely sets it apart.

“The futuristic cuts and edges running across the aluminum case might be divisive, but I absolutely love it. It’s quite tastefully done, giving the keyboard an edge in terms of pure aesthetics and style without going overboard.”

“The ERA75 comes with a rotary knob for volume control, and it operates buttery smooth with enough haptic steps so you are not just spinning it out of control every time. What’s even better is that it can be easily plucked out and replaced with the included home key (complete with keycap and extra switches in the box) if you prefer a cleaner look.”

  • HLPLANET --- A solid keyboard for office work and for gaming.

“Typing on the Era75 is smooth, and I really enjoyed the sound profile. The factory lubed linear POM palm switches from Womier feel good and consistent. If you do not like them, you can swap them easily since the PCB is hot swappable and south facing. The stabilizers are pre-lubed. They are plate mounted, not PCB mounted, but there is no noticeable rattle, which is nice at this price.”

“The board supports VIA, so key remapping and lighting changes are easy. You can remap keys, create macros, and adjust RGB settings directly in your browser. The ERA75 offers full per-key RGB with 17 built-in effects, so you can easily match your setup’s mood and style.”
